Always turn off hyphenation; it makes .\" way too many mistakes in technical documents. .if n .ad l .nh .SH NAME AptPkg::Version \- APT package versioning class .SH SYNOPSIS .IX Header "SYNOPSIS" use AptPkg::Version; .SH DESCRIPTION .IX Header "DESCRIPTION" The AptPkg::Version module provides an interface to \fBAPT\fR's package version handling. .SS AptPkg::Version .IX Subsection "AptPkg::Version" The AptPkg::Version package implements the \fBAPT\fR pkgVersioningSystem class. .PP An instance of the AptPkg::Version class may be fetched using the \&\f(CW\*(C`versioning\*(C'\fR method from an AptPkg::System object. .PP The following methods are implemented: .IP label 4 .IX Item "label" Return the description of the versioning system, for example: .Sp .Vb 1 \& Standard .deb .Ve .Sp for Debian systems. .IP "compare(\fIA\fR, \fIB\fR)" 4 .IX Item "compare(A, B)" Compare package version \fIA\fR with \fIB\fR, returning a negative value if \&\fIA\fR is an earlier version than \fIB\fR, zero if the same or a positive value if \fIA\fR is later. .IP "rel_compare(\fIA\fR, \fIB\fR)" 4 .IX Item "rel_compare(A, B)" Compare distribution release numbers. .IP "check_dep(\fIPKG\fR, \fIOP\fR, \fIDEP\fR)" 4 .IX Item "check_dep(PKG, OP, DEP)" Check that the package version \fIPKG\fR satisfies the relation \fIOP\fR to the dependency version \fIDEP\fR. .Sp The relation \fIOP\fR is specified in the Debian syntax regardless of the versioning system: .Sp .Vb 5 \& << strictly earlier \& <= earlier or equal \& = exactly equal \& >= later or equal \& >> strictly later .Ve .IP upstream(\fIVER\fR) 4 .IX Item "upstream(VER)" Return the upstream component of the given version string. .SH "SEE ALSO" .IX Header "SEE ALSO" \&\fBAptPkg::Config\fR\|(3pm), \fBAptPkg::System\fR\|(3pm), \fBAptPkg\fR\|(3pm). .SH AUTHOR .IX Header "AUTHOR" Brendan O'Dea
